SBI Holdings invests in Wirex to establish Asia focussed JV on cryptocurrency payment

The new joint venture, SBI Wirex Asia, follows a previous investment this year of $3 million by SBI Group in Wirex.

Under this partnership, Wirex will benefit from SBI Holdings’ support, scale and Asian market relationships whereas SBI Holdings will achieve access to Japan’s cryptocurrency payments card market. (Photo/Wirex)

Bitcoin payments firm Wirex has signed a deal with Japan's FinTech investor, , to establish a new Asia focussed joint venture, SBI Wirex Asia which will deliver a Japanese payment card and joint businesses, said company.

Under this partnership, Wirex will benefit from SBI Holdings' support, scale and Asian market relationships whereas SBI Holdings will achieve access to Japan's cryptocurrency payments card provider and expertise in the blockchain based finance.

“Our new relationship with SBI Holdings enables us to deepen our already market leading position in the country to offer new Japan and Asia focussed products and services. I look forward to working with the team at SBI,” said Pavel Matveev, CEO, Wirex.

“Japanese customers are our most enthusiastic supporters and use our VISA-backed cryptocurrency debit card more regularly than anywhere else in the world. They deserve a Yen denominated card soon and we will deliver it to them,” he added.

The new joint venture follows a previous investment this year of $3 million by SBI Group. Wirex and SBI Wirex Asia will work closely together to ensure Japanese customers benefit from Wirex's global community and expertise with the support of SBI Wirex Asia.

“I am pleased to see SBI Holdings enter into a relationship with Wirex, which will offer Japanese customers much improved choice and flexibility when it comes to cryptocurrency payments,” said Wataru Kojima, Wirex Japan CEO.

“Japan leads the world in regulation and our accountants are armed with the tools to accept bitcoin on balance sheets. I will ensure Japan maintains our preeminent position in this space though providing the most innovative and cost-effective technologies globally, he added.

Wirex is one of the Japan's most popular provider of cryptocurrency debit cards. It claimed that it serves 900,000 customers in more than 130 countries and is in the process of obtaining an e-money license in the United Kingdom. BCompany achieved $1 billion of transaction volume in June 2017 and has offices in London, Tokyo and Kiev. Wirex is expected to offer contactless bitcoin payments, contactless cards, additional currencies and new bitcoin-based financial products in the near future.
